Programación de los bloques de función estándares
Diagrama de tiempo
REQ
DONE
ERROR
1
Activación de la función por flanco positivo (usuario)
2
Acuse positivo: servicio PI ejecutado satisfactoriamente
3
Desactivación de la petición de función tras la llegada del acuse (usuario)
4
Cambio de señal realizado por el FB
Acuse negativo: se ha producido un error; el código del mismo se encuentra en el
5
parámetro de salida "STATE"
Figura 6-6
Diagrama de tiempo para el FB 4
Para ver un ejemplo de llamada para selección de programa,
aplicación 4 del apartado 6.8.4
Abrir el proyecto de ejemplo
"zEn16_01_FM357-2_BF_EX\EXAMPLES\Sources\EXAMPLE4", desde el Administrador
SIMATIC, con el menú Archivo > Abrir... > Proyecto.
Fragmento de la tabla de símbolos:
Símbolo
FM_PI
DI_FB4
USERDB
Fragmento del "USERDB" con la estructura del "EX4" con la ruta donde se encuentra el
programa principal y el nombre de éste:
Nombre
PATH
P_NAME
...
6-42
1
3
2
4
Dirección
Tipo de dato
FB 4
FB 4
DB 119
FB 4
DB 115
DB 115
Tipo
STRING[32]
'/_N_MPF_DIR/'
STRING[32]
'_N_PROG_MPF'
...
...
END_STRUCT
Módulo de posicionamiento multieje FM 357-2 para servoaccionamientos y motores paso a paso
1
5
General services
Instance DB for FB 4
User DB for examples
Valor inicial
Main program path
Program name PROG
...
3
4
véase también el ejemplo de
Comentarios
Comentarios
A5E00176151-01